Organizing arranges people and resources to work toward a goal. As one of the most basic components of management, it involves dividing the labor and coordinating results to achieve a common purpose. Organization structure is the system of tasks, reporting relationships and communication linkages within an organization. This can be visually seen with an organization chart. By looking at an organization chart, we learn the basics of an organization"s formal structure. The informal structure is the set of unofficial relationships among an organization"s members. Social network analysis is a great tool for understanding informal structures and the social relationships that are active in an organization. *no organization can be fully understood without gaining insight into the informal structure as well as the formal one. Informal structures are key to the success of any organization, especially during times of change or in unusual situations. They provide, quick spontaneous help which allows an organization to get things done.
